Subject: Catalog cache invalidation — on-call notes

Welcome aboard. The Harrowmede product catalog uses event-driven invalidation: price and inventory updates publish purge messages that the edge caches consume. If the purge stream lags, stale prices can be served, which has compliance implications, so treat lag alerts as high priority. Never issue a global flush without approval from the Veldane security group. The full invalidation procedure is documented on the page below.

operations page: https://jenkins.zemvarcloud.local/job/merge_requests/repo/build/73930b4b30f0a8ed

## Break-Glass: EXIF Scrubber

Quick note for the sync: if PixelRinse (our EXIF scrubbing service) jams and photos start leaking metadata, break-glass access lets you halt the upload pipeline immediately. It's loud — alerts everyone — so only use it for real leaks. To activate break-glass mode, enter the recovery passphrase below.

vault phrase of fawep-hagug = aldius-druwyn-holael-ulamir-rusius-aldmir

Changelog 2.8.0 — Circuit Breaker Defaults (Bramblegate Gateway)

Defaults for the upstream API breaker changed. Trip threshold is lower, half-open probes are slower, and failure windows are now sliding rather than fixed. Plugins relying on old retry timing should adjust. Override in your plugin manifest if needed. The new defaults ship as follows.

settings of kagap-fajep:
[zorys]
team = ulavan
access_code = ac_08fa8f
host = zorys.kelvinet.corp
port = 3000
owner = wenix.weneth
peer = wenath.brasksys.test